If you're looking for a place to have your drinks with your friends at night. You might want to consider these spots.
1) Kedai Kopi (next to Rasta, Taman Tun Dr.Ismail)
This place opens at night, they serve wonderful Hang Tuah coffee. I bet some of you are not familiar with this brand. It's way better than your "Kopi Kapal Api" or the likes. Original coffee lovers will surely love this place. Their roti bakar (toast) taste great too.
Recommendation: Hang Tuah coffee and Roti Bakar (Toast)
2) Steven's Corner (near Menara MaxiSegar, Pandah Indah)
This place is your typical mamak. Cleanliness is not up to my standard but still acceptable. I would only recommend one thing here, Steven's Corner Cheese Nan. So, if you are a cheese nan lover, I can guarantee you that you will love the cheese nan here.
Recommendation: Cheese Nan
3) Suzi Corner, Ampang (same row as Flamingo Hotel, next to a car wash centre)
This place is located in Ampang, near MRR2. As of now, I could only recommend their mamak style mee goreng (fried noodle mamak style). You may want to add to this.
Recommendation: Mee Goreng Mamak

Jom Makan (Let's Eat) - Part 2
I manage to make time for Jom Makan (Let's Eat) - Part 2. Check it out.
1. Nasi Beriani Gam (Beriani Gam Rice) a.k.a Beriani Gam Batu Pahat - Putrajaya (Next to UNITEN)
This place serve the best nasi beriani gam in Klang Valley. Nasi Beriani Gam Putrajaya originated from Batu Pahat, Johor. They serve nasi beriani gam, nasi beriani, mutton, chicken, beef and venison (i am not sure if they still serve this). This place is open from 12pm - 10pm.
Recommendation : Nasi Beriani Gam Putrajaya (with mutton, chicken, beef, etc.). You will get a big plate of nasi beriani that will make you lick your fingers and your plate (okay, that's a little exaggerating... he he)
2. Sup Daging (Beef Soup) - (near Public Bank Training Centre, Kajang and UNITEN)
This humble stall sells one of the best Beef soup in Klang Valley and it's cheap. You can have your soup with nasi lemak. This place opens on weekdays from 11am - 3pm.
Recommendation: Sup Daging and Sup Tulang
3. Nasi Beriani Insaf (Jalan Tuanku Abdul Rahman, KL)
This famous restaurant sells the best beriani in KL. Whilst the price is slightly higher, you will find it worth it.
Recommendation: Nasi beriani + ayam madu
4. Raju Restaurant (Jalan Gasing)
This restaurant is popular to those who resides in Petaling Jaya and neighbouring area. You will find this place packed during weekends, especially in the morning. What ever you normally see at your usual mamak, u can find it here.
Recommendation: Chapati, Ikan Bolos goreng (fried bolos fish), paper tosai.

Jom Makan (Let's Eat) - Part 1
I would share with you some of the places that serve good food at reasonable price. Being a guy who grew up in Klang Valley and treat makan as more that a need, I would feel guilty if I do not share this with the rest. I just love to eat. I am doing a favor for myself to start this topic because I can list all the places I love to go to have my makan, and I can see it online. I will not go into detail like giving a review on the menu because it is going to be boring...Instead, I will tell you what is the recommended food/meal for you to have at the place. Come, let me show you.
1. Rendezvous Restaurant, (Near Kg.Pandan roundabout)
Its welcoming ambience and accessibility makes it a perfect place for a first date or even a family gathering. There are variety of food to choose from. They serve western, eastern and malaysian cuisine.
Recommendation: Rendezvous Escargots. It is served with one hell of a wonderful cream. Also in my order list its delicious Rendezvous Chicken Cheese.
2. Cozy Corner (Ampang Park)
This is my mom and dad's favourite place. They used to take my younger sister and I to have our makan there when we were small back in the 90's. This place is famous for its western food.
Recommendation: It's Dried Chilli Prawns with Cashewnuts. You can have this to go with steamed rice. Trust me, it is delicious and it has always been my mom's favourite. My dad and I, we have always loved Cozy's Lamb Steak - it is really juicy, tender and fresh. I bet my sister would suggest Cozy's fish and chips - the fish is fresh and the chips taste just great.
3. Restoran Murni, SS2 - Roti Ayam
This restaurant right here is well-known for its Roti Ayam SS2 (chicken meat wrapped in roti canai) and Big-Cup Fruit Juice. A collegemate brought me here in 2004, (thank's Naj!).
Recommendation: Roti Ayam! The chicken is wrapped in a roti canai with mayonnaise on top and served with chicken curry. I bet you won't find any other mamak that serves this "sedap gila" Roti Ayam in town. :)
4. Chee Meng Restaurant - Jalan Bukit Bintang
This recommendation sells the BEST nasi ayam (chicken rice) ever! Once you have your nasi ayam here, I can bet you will not go to places like Chicken Rice Shop or the new Chicken Rice Restaurant that faces Bukit Bintang (BB) Plaza.
Recommendation: Nasi Ayam (chicken rice) of course. Kerabu Mangga, both steamed and roasted chicken, tofu and wantan.
